The team building Dogger Bank Wind Farm has officially marked the start of its offshore construction work with the installation of the first length of HVDC export cable off the Yorkshire coast.

Tier one supplier NKT is leading the work to install the Dogger Bank A nearshore cable, that will connect the first phase of the windfarm more than 130km off the coast to a landfall point at Ulrome, in East Riding of Yorkshire.

Aberdeenshire-based ACE Winches and LMR Drilling UK Ltd of Birkenhead are among the companies supporting NKT with this work.

The campaign will continue during 2022, with work starting on the export cables for Dogger Bank B in East Riding, and Dogger Bank C on Teesside, in the consecutive years.

Dogger Bank Wind Farm will be the first HVDC connected wind farm in the UK, paving the way for other UK wind farms and suppliers to build on our experience transmitting renewable energy safely and efficiently across long distances while minimising potential losses.

Dogger Bank Wind Farm is being built in three phases known as A, B and C. The project is a joint venture between SSE Renewables (40%), Equinor (40%) and Eni Plenitude (20%).

NKT will supply and install the onshore and offshore HVDC cable for all three phases of the project. The company will use its cable-laying vessel NKT Victoria to install the 320kV DC subsea cable system in the challenging North Sea conditions.

Dogger Bank Wind Farm’s tier one contractor Hitachi Energy will begin to transport electricity transformers from Hull to the project’s East Riding convertor station site near Cottingham from May 8.

The transformers will travel from Albert Dock, Hull via A63, A1034 and the A1079. The size of the transformers requires the use of abnormal load vehicles. There will be four deliveries during the month of May, expected to be made on the mornings of 8, 15, 22 and 29 May, with each delivery taking up to six hours, dependent on the conditions.

The transformers will be delivered on specialist girder frame trailers provided by UK firm Allelys. The trucks will be more than 58.2 metres long and 4.75 metres wide and will travel at approximately 10 -15  miles per hour. To support the delivery the team has worked with contractors and local highway officials from East Riding of Yorkshire Council to carefully plan the route and minimise disruption to road users. The specialist girder frame trailer will have a police escort to help manage traffic and make the process as smooth and safe as possible.

Overview of the route:

The delivery convoy consisting of the abnormal load vehicle, police and support vehicles will leave the Albert Dock in Hull and make its way westbound, along the A63 to join the A1034 at South Cave heading north. The convoy will then join the A1079 at Market Weighton, heading east until the outskirts of Beverley, where the vehicle will turn south remaining on the A1079 and is expected to arrive at the convertor station site entrance, located between Beverley and Cottingham in the afternoon on the specified dates.

The transformers will play an integral role in the operation of two onshore convertor stations in East Riding of Yorkshire that are currently under construction at the A1079 site between Beverley and Cottingham. Eventually they will convert the current from the wind farm for transmission via the national grid network to millions of UK homes after the renewable energy has made its way under the ground from the landfall point at Ulrome, between Bridlington and Hornsea.

Dogger Bank Wind Farm will be located more than 130 km off the northeast coast and will generate enough renewable energy to power six million UK homes. A joint venture between SSE Renewables, Equinor and Eni, SSE Renewables is leading on Dogger Bank construction and delivery while Equinor will operate the wind farm on completion.

The wind farm is being built in three consecutive phases, connecting to the National Grid in both East Riding of Yorkshire and on Teesside. The third phase of the wind farm, Dogger Bank C, will reach landfall at Marske-by-the-sea. The underground onshore cables will be routed to an onshore convertor station near Lazenby, where preparation work is already underway. Once the current is converted, the renewable energy will make its way to an existing National Grid substation at Lackenby.

Dogger Bank Wind Farm has awarded a contract for the transport and installation of the Dogger Bank C offshore substation to Heerema Marine Contractors.

The work will include transporting and installing the 3,500 metric ton jacket foundation, four main piles, and the 9,500 metric ton offshore substation topside. Heerema will perform offshore lifting to position the jacket foundation on the scour bed, using main piles to provide jacket on-bottom stability. The offshore substation will be lifted from a barge prior to set-down on the jacket foundation.

Dogger Bank C is the third phase of the world-leading Dogger Bank Wind Farm project, a joint venture offshore wind farm being constructed off the north-east coast of England by partners SSE Renewables, Equinor and Eni. Due to its size and scale, Dogger Bank is being built in three consecutive 1.2GW phases; Dogger Bank A, Dogger Bank B and Dogger Bank C. Dogger Bank C is around 560km² in size and at its closest point is 196km from shore.

SSE Renewables is leading the development and construction of Dogger Bank Wind Farm while Equinor will operate the wind farm on completion for its expected operational life of 35 years.

Dogger Bank Wind Farm will be the largest offshore wind farm in the world when operational in 2026, with an overall capacity of 3.6GW. In total the wind farm is expected to generate enough renewable electricity to supply 5% of the UK’s demand, equivalent to powering six million homes.

An innovative new inter-array cable monitoring system that will help technicians identify and prevent potential faults is set to be deployed for the first time on Dogger Bank Wind Farm.

The ECG™ holistic cable monitoring system has been developed in the UK by Proserv Controls. It provides operators with real-time data for improved decision-making and supporting optimum operating efficiency.

The technology will be used for the first time on the first two phases of Dogger Bank Wind Farm, after the company was awarded a contract with Dogger Bank tier one supplier, DEME.

The Proserv order follows on from a cable protection system (CPS) contract being awarded to Darlington-based Tekmar Energy Limited. The Generation 10 TekTube contract with DEME is Tekmar’s largest CPS order to date.
